Ok, measurements are taken and a formula used to estimate the weight of a pumpkin. Then, when the pumpkin is weighed the actual weight is compared to the estimated weight. So if the pumpkin estimated 1000 pounds and the actual weight is 1100 pounds, the pumpkin is said to "go heavy to the chart". The cross is when you plant 2 different seeds. On one plant you pollinate the female blossom with a male blossom from the other plant. This is done when you want to combine certain genetics into one seed.
